3) What is expected to happen in LibreOffice Writer via the Terminal:

cd ~/Desktop && wget https://bugs.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+source/openoffice.org/+bug/525717/+attachment/2369876/+files/example.odt && lowriter -nologo example.odt

when one uses the mouse and selects the blue text → clicks Format Paintbrush → selects “jumps over” in the green text, only those two words have their format changed.

4) What happens instead is “jumps over” changed to the desired formatting but the font, font color, and size of the words to the left and right, as well as the paragraph justification changed to Default Formatting.

WORKAROUND: Use the mouse and select the blue text → click Format Paintbrush → press and hold the Ctrl key -> select “jumps over” in the green text then let go.

turbolad, as per upstream rationale it is agreed this is not a bug:

As per: http://help.libreoffice.org/Common/Copying_Attributes_With_the_Format_Paintbrush when "Text is selected" it is noted that it "Copies the formatting of the last selected character and of the paragraph that contains the character." While the default action is not intuitive, the WORKAROUND does give one the opportunity to achieve the expected results.
